On Thu, 17 Mar 2005 17:54:13 -0500 (EST), Seth Breidbart wrote:
And post to the list using what address? And what if someone attempts
to reply to her offlist? And what if a spammer finds the list archive
on the web? (How do you distinguish between the latter 2 cases? Or
are they treated like ordinary email to the base account, with only
the list mail being whitelisted? How is _it_ distinguished?)
these are the right questions.
the prvs scheme in batv works because only the original administration needs to
understand the convention. for the reasons you are citing -- namely that the
mailing list needs to know which bits really are for addressing and which are
for validating, and it needs to keep the validation ones hidden from other list
members -- the mailing list needs to support the scheme.
